Hi everybody, I'm sharing this time a great resource we created together during the eTwinning Learning Event "eTwinners go social: creating and managing a successful Teachers' Room".

I ran the Learning Event in December 2012, together with a great team of co-managers: Antonella Ciriello, Elena Pezzi, Maria Rosaria Fasanelli, PAola Arduini and Monika Kiss.

It was a wonderful thrilling experience, not only for what we taught and learned concerning Teachers' Rooms and our place in the eTwinning geography, but also because, once more, we experienced the power of teams.
And then, it was a special experience because of the people we had the opportunity to meet.

Believe me, whatever you are doing, if you do it together it will come out a lot better - often in an unespected direction.

This time, together with the participants, we decided to share our reflections and opinions with a wider public of eTwinners - and not only. We believed our ideas, tips and suggestions should go further than the closed space of the Learning Lab.

That's why, at the end of our journey, we created this Teachers' Rooms Handbook.
